Foodborne Pathogens: Risks and Consequences

Task Force Reports - R122 - September 1994
Download Publication

Better data on microbial risks are needed to make the U.S. food supply safer. Cochairs: Peggy M. Foegeding, Department of Food Science, North Carolina State University, Raleigh, and Tanya Roberts, Economic Research Service, U.S. Department of Agriculture.

R122, September 1994, 87 pp. Available free online and in print (fee for shipping/handling).
